Rogue prioritizes compact-SUV versatility and efficiency, while Murano moves toward a more premium two-row experience with a different powertrain, cabin, and price position.
Direct answer
Choose Rogue when its shorter exterior, larger published cargo area and higher EPA estimates matter more than a larger cabin. Choose Murano when its 241-horsepower engine, roomier two-row interior and cabin design justify the added size and transaction cost. Both seat five, so load the same cargo and compare seat comfort, visibility and exact equipment.

How do the specifications compare?
On a small screen, scroll horizontally to compare every column.
| Decision | 2026.5 Nissan Rogue | 2027 Nissan Murano |
|---|---|---|
| Seating capacity | 5 | 5 |
| Engine output | 201 hp / 225 lb-ft | 241 hp / 260 lb-ft |
| Overall length | 183.0 in. | 192.9 in. |
| Passenger volume | 100.4–105.4 cu. ft. | 107.1–112.0 cu. ft. |
| Cargo behind second row | 36.3–36.5 cu. ft. | 32.9 cu. ft. |
| Maximum cargo | 72.9–74.1 cu. ft. | 63.5 cu. ft. |
| Fuel tank and EPA rating | 14.5 gal.; up to 29/36 mpg | 18.7 gal.; 21/27/23 mpg |
Features and availability vary by model year, trim, drivetrain, package, and current inventory. Confirm the exact vehicle before purchase.
What should you check on a New Rochelle test drive?
Drive both through a narrow parking lot and a rough-road section, then sit in the rear seat with the front seat set for the regular driver. Load the same bags rather than assuming the larger exterior automatically creates the more useful cargo area.
Customer questions and answers
Is Murano a three-row SUV?
No. Murano is a two-row SUV. If a third row is required, compare Pathfinder or another three-row vehicle.
Is Rogue always more fuel-efficient?
Do not assume. Check current EPA estimates for the exact engine and drivetrain, then account for your speed, weather, load, and driving pattern.
Does premium positioning mean Murano has every feature standard?
No. Features still vary by trim, package, model year, and inventory. Compare the exact equipment list.
